Each section of a spinner is labeled with a unique number and is the same size and shape as the other sections. the spinner is spun two times. the number of possible outcomes is 16. how many sections is the spinner divided into?

Answer:

The spinner is divided into 4 sections

Explanation:

Each section of a spinner is labeled with a unique number and is the same size and shape as the other sections.

On spinning the spinner is two times,the number of possible outcomes is 16.

Let number of outcomes on spinning it once be n

Then, number of outcomes on spinning it twice will be n²

(since, if 1,2,3 are outcomes in one spin than outcomes in two spins are:

11 12 13

21 22 23

31 32 33)

n²=16 ⇒ n=4

Hence, spinner is divided into 4 sections
